SOCI 3600: Sociology of Education
3.00 Credits
LaGrange College
On demand This course will examine, from a sociological perspective, the structure and process of education in contemporary society, and its effects. The primary focus will be on U.S. public education. Topics include the contribution of sociology to understanding education and teaching; the relationship of education to other social institutions such as families and religion; the effects of socio-demographic variables on learning outcomes, etc.

SOCI 4200: Social Inequality
3.00 Credits
LaGrange College
Fall This course will examine social inequality, a topic which is at the core of sociological analysis and research. The classical perspectives on inequality will be examined, as well as the contemporary extensions of these approaches. Particular attention will be paid to class, race, and gender as separate and as intersecting axes of inequality. Prerequisite: SOCI 1000, with a grade of "C" or higher.

SOCI 4500: Sociology/Anthropology Internship
3.00 - 6.00 Credits
LaGrange College
On demand This course requires 120 hours of supervised experience (per 3 credit hours) in a local agency or office, selected readings, as well as an oral presentation given in one of the SOCI/ANTH courses. Applications for internships must be submitted to the department chair in the term or semester prior to placement. Students may select a graded or Pass/No Credit option. Course may be repeated twice (for 3 hours credit) for a maximum of 6 hours credit. This course will not count towards the major in Sociology. Prerequisites: Completion of SOCI 1000 with a grade of "C" orhigher as well as at least two other courses with the SOCI or ANTH prefix with grades of "C" orhigher.
